Ski suits; knitted or crocheted

HS v2022 Code: 611220

About ski suits; knitted or crocheted

HS code 611220 covers the import and export of ski suits that are knitted or crocheted. Production process

The production of knitted or crocheted ski suits typically involves a multi-step process. First, the raw materials, such as synthetic fibers or natural wool, are sourced and processed into yarns. These yarns are then knitted or crocheted into the desired fabric patterns, often incorporating features like moisture-wicking properties, insulation, and wind resistance. The fabric is then cut and sewn into the final ski suit design, which may include additional elements like zippers, pockets, and reinforced panels for durability and functionality.

Production inputs

The main inputs required for the production of HS code 611220 ski suits include synthetic fibers (e.g., polyester, nylon), natural fibers (e.g., wool, cashmere), knitting or crocheting machinery, sewing equipment, and various trimmings and accessories like zippers, buttons, and reflective elements. Additionally, the industry relies on skilled labor, design expertise, and access to advanced textile technologies to ensure the production of high-quality, functional, and fashionable ski suits.
